Sonic the Hedgehog 2 HD wins Game of the Year in Narnia photo

Wallpaper designer Alchemist Defined has just ruined my day. He (she?) created an absolutely stunning mock-up image of what Sonic the Hedgehog 2 could look like in HD and now I can’t focus on anything else. All I see when I look down at this mound of work on my desk are images of a beautifully rendered blue hedgehog running through a gloriously polished parallax scrolling universe. Even though it isn’t real, I want this game ... bad.

Hopefully someone at SEGA checks this out and realizes that this is what fans want to see Sonic look like in HD (not this or this). Seriously, can you imagine? Once I am done playing the sequel to Beyond Good & Evil in my fictional videogame world, this is defintiely next.

While it's obviously not news, I just had to share the beauty of this pic with you guys. Check the gallery below for the larger, desktop-ready version (it looks even better blown up!).

What do you all think? Are you drooling all over your keyboard like I am?
